网站载网页游戏:阵容巧配与脚本冗余码高效优
|
如今,越来越多网站选择嵌入网页游戏来提升用户停留时长与互动体验。这类游戏无需下载,点开即玩,极大降低了参与门槛。而在实际运营中,能否让玩家持续感兴趣,关键不仅在于画面与玩法,更在于阵容搭配的策略性与后台代码的运行效率。 优秀的网页游戏往往设计了丰富的角色系统,玩家需根据敌方配置、关卡机制灵活调整己方阵容。这种“巧配”不只是简单的强弱对比,而是涉及属性克制、技能联动和出手顺序等多重因素。例如,前排坦克若能有效吸收伤害,配合后排输出的爆发时机,就能在有限回合内逆转战局。合理的阵容组合让玩家感受到思考的乐趣,也增强了重复挑战的动力。 然而,再精妙的玩法设计,若被卡顿、加载慢或频繁报错拖累,用户体验也会大打折扣。这背后常源于脚本中存在大量冗余代码。比如重复定义的函数、未清理的事件监听、过度嵌套的条件判断等,都会增加浏览器负担,尤其在低端设备上更为明显。冗余码不仅影响性能,还可能导致内存泄漏,使游戏运行一段时间后自动崩溃。 为提升效率,开发者应注重代码结构的简洁与模块化。通过封装常用功能、使用事件委托替代多个绑定、及时释放无用变量等方式,可显著减少资源消耗。同时,利用现代前端工具如Webpack进行打包压缩,剔除无用代码,也能有效缩小脚本体积,加快加载速度。轻量化的脚本意味着更快的响应和更流畅的操作体验。 值得注意的是,优化不应以牺牲可维护性为代价。清晰的命名、必要的注释和合理的分层架构,能让后续更新更高效。当游戏需要新增角色或调整机制时,良好的代码基础可以快速适配,避免“牵一发而动全身”的重构困境。技术上的前瞻性,往往决定了产品的生命周期。 从玩家角度看,一个让人愿意反复打开的游戏,必然是既有趣味深度又运行稳定的。巧妙的阵容搭配激发策略思维,高效的脚本保障流畅体验,二者相辅相成。网站在引入此类游戏时,不应只关注内容本身,更要审视其技术实现是否经得起高并发与多终端的考验。 未来,随着WebAssembly等新技术的应用,网页游戏的表现力与性能将进一步逼近原生应用。但无论技术如何演进,核心逻辑不变:好的交互设计需要扎实的技术支撑。只有当创意与效率并重,网页游戏才能真正成为网站吸引用户的有力武器。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

浙公网安备 33038102330577号